It's only 4mm taller than the iStick, and the connector is above the battery, so I can't imagine that it's a sprung 510!

Specs are here: http://www.szecigarette.com/products/709.html

Power: 9 - 30W
Voltage: 3.0 - 5.5V

That's not a very big range of volts! Judging by those ranges, 1 ohm would be the sweet spot where you actually get 9 - 30W available.
